Understanding Calcium Citrate
Calcium is an essential mineral that is vital for various bodily functions, including bone health, muscle function, and nerve transmission. Calcium citrate is a highly absorbable form of calcium that is often recommended for individuals who may have difficulty absorbing other forms of calcium, such as calcium carbonate.
Benefits of Calcium Citrate
1. Bone Health: Calcium citrate supports the development and maintenance of strong bones and teeth. It is especially important for older adults who are at a higher risk of osteoporosis.
2. Digestive Health: Unlike some other calcium supplements, calcium citrate can be taken on an empty stomach without causing gastrointestinal discomfort.
3. Heart Health: Adequate calcium intake is associated with maintaining a healthy heart rhythm and reducing the risk of cardiovascular diseases.
The Role of Vitamin D3
Vitamin D3, also known as cholecalciferol, is a fat-soluble vitamin that plays a pivotal role in calcium absorption and bone health. It can be obtained through sunlight exposure, certain foods, and dietary supplements.
Benefits of Vitamin D3
1. Enhanced Calcium Absorption: Vitamin D3 enhances the intestinal absorption of calcium, ensuring that your body effectively utilizes the calcium you consume.
2. Immune Support: This vitamin is also known for its role in supporting the immune system, helping the body fend off illnesses and infections.
3. Mood Regulation: Research suggests that adequate levels of vitamin D3 may help improve mood and reduce the risk of depression.
The Importance of Folic Acid
Folic acid, or vitamin B9, is a water-soluble vitamin crucial for DNA synthesis, cell division, and overall growth. It is particularly important for pregnant women, as it helps prevent neural tube defects in developing fetuses.
Benefits of Folic Acid
1. Supports Healthy Pregnancy: Folic acid is essential for fetal development and helps reduce the risk of birth defects.
2. Reduces Homocysteine Levels: Folic acid helps lower homocysteine levels, a type of amino acid that, when elevated, can increase the risk of heart disease.
3. Boosts Mental Health: Some studies suggest that adequate folic acid intake may be linked to a lower risk of cognitive decline and mood disorders.

How to Incorporate These Nutrients into Your Diet
To reap the benefits of calcium citrate, vitamin D3, and folic acid, consider the following tips:
1. Supplements: Choose high-quality supplements that combine these nutrients for convenience.
2. Dietary Sources: Incorporate foods rich in these nutrients:
– Calcium: Dairy products, leafy greens, and fortified foods.
– Vitamin D: Fatty fish, fortified milk, and egg yolks.
– Folic Acid: Leafy greens, legumes, nuts, and fortified cereals.
3. Sun Exposure: Aim for regular sunlight exposure to boost your vitamin D levels naturally.
